Finance Review Summary — Sales Leads

Quick read on the numbers behind the possible Quillbrook acquisition: their recurring revenue is solid, margins a touch thin, and the overlap with our Tidemark line is bigger than first thought. Integration costs look manageable. Nothing's signed, so keep this off customer calls entirely. Here's where leadership currently stands on the deal.

confidential, bahof-yaweg: Headcount on the Kaseth team goes from 32 to 109 by the end of January. Gross margin on Kaseth came in at 46 percent against a plan of 45 percent.

Handover — Ashdown regional chess final, score sheets

All 64 original score sheets from the Ashdown final are boxed, sorted by round, sealed Tuesday evening. Arbiter signatures verified against the pairing list; two disputed games flagged with red tabs, don't separate them from the bundle. Federation wants originals archived within ten days, so no delays. Digital scans already uploaded; the paper copies are the legal record. Courier booked with Larkfield Runners for Thursday morning. Hand-over instruction below — follow it to the letter.

handover note for yagef-bagep: the drudor pelius courier leaves the kasdor zorvan norir ledger at gate 8016 under passcode 755406

Minutes — Management Meeting, Regional Sales Review

Present: full management committee. The Vessory region exceeded target by 7%; Calthrop underperformed due to distributor churn. Approved: revised Calthrop incentive scheme, effective next month. Noted: board to receive full figures quarterly. One further matter was recorded for the board in the confidential note below.

board note of kageg-bahof: The renewal with Holwynax Holdings closes at $2 million a year, 5 percent below the last contract. Project Ulaath slips by two quarters because of the supplier delay.

## Tuning

Profilecask shards user profiles by hashed account key across the Brindle ring. Support teams should not rebalance manually; the router handles shard splits automatically once a shard crosses its size threshold. Replication lag alerts fire at the watermark defined in config. The shipped defaults, which most deployments should keep, are as follows.

tuning constants:
BUDGETS = {
    "druath": 240,
    "lamwyn": 180,
    "silael": 275,
}